Kappiton Guarantee

Kappiton Mattresses: 10-Year Warranty (including the statutory legal warranty)

Kappiton Mattress Covers: 3-Year Warranty

Kappiton provides this Limited Warranty for its mattresses and their corresponding covers (collectively referred to as the "Product"), valid in the country where the Product was originally purchased.

The total warranty period for mattresses is 10 (ten) years from the original date of purchase, including the 3-year statutory legal warranty required under Portuguese law.

Mattress covers are covered by a 3 (three) year warranty, corresponding to the statutory legal warranty period, exclusively against manufacturing defects.

1. Legal Framework

Under Portuguese Decree-Law No. 84/2021 of October 18, consumers purchasing movable goods in Portugal benefit from a 3 (three) year statutory legal warranty covering any lack of conformity.

During this period, consumers are entitled, as provided by law, to have the Product brought into conformity through repair, replacement, an appropriate price reduction, or termination of the purchase contract.

For the first 2 (two) years, any lack of conformity is presumed to have existed at the time of delivery unless proven otherwise.

This commercial warranty applies after the statutory legal warranty expires, extending the total mattress warranty coverage to 10 years from the original purchase date.

Nothing in this warranty limits or excludes any statutory consumer rights.

2. Warranty Period

Mattresses

Total warranty period: 10 years from the original purchase date.

  • Years 0–3: Statutory legal warranty.
  • Years 3–10: Kappiton Commercial Warranty.

Mattress Covers

Warranty period: 3 years from the original purchase date, covering manufacturing defects only.

The warranty period begins on the date shown on the original proof of purchase.

3. Who Is Covered

This warranty applies exclusively to the original purchaser of the Product and requires valid proof of purchase.

The warranty is personal, non-transferable, and automatically terminates if the Product is sold, gifted, or otherwise transferred to another owner.

4. What Is Covered

Mattress

During the commercial warranty period (Years 3–10), coverage is limited to manufacturing and material defects, including:

  • Visible body impressions exceeding 4 cm (1.6 inches) that are not caused by an unsuitable foundation or improper use.
  • Cracks, splits, or abnormal deterioration of the foam under normal use.
  • Structural manufacturing defects that compromise the integrity of the mattress.

To remain eligible for warranty coverage, the mattress must be used on a firm and structurally suitable foundation.

For slatted bed bases:

  • Each slat must be at least 5 cm (2 inches) wide.
  • The spacing between slats must not exceed 9 cm (3.5 inches).
  • The bed frame must be suitable for supporting both the mattress and its intended users.

Mattress Cover

During the 3-year warranty period, coverage is limited to:

  • Manufacturing defects in workmanship.
  • Structural stitching defects.
  • Zipper defects resulting from manufacturing errors.
